lunresertib
0 ImagesSynonyms: RP-6306lunresertib (RP-6306) is a potent, selective and orally active PKMYT1 inhibitor with an IC50 of 14 nM. lunresertib shows a high degree of selectivity over other kinases in cellular binding assays. lunresertib shows anticancer effects. -

Zedoresertib
0 ImagesSynonyms: Debio 0123; WEE1-IN-5Zedoresertib (Debio 0123) is a potent WEE1 inhibitor with an IC50 value of 0.8 nM. Zedoresertib inhibits phospho-CDC2. Zedoresertib abrogates the G2 check point, increasing sensitivity to DNA damaging agents in cancer cells. Zedoresertib can be used for researching anticancer. -

XL495
0 ImagesCat. No.: HY-182906CAS No.: 3040320-93-9XL495 is an potent, selective and orally active PKMYT1 inhibitor. XL495 inhibits CDK1 Thr14 phosphorylation and induces KAP1 Ser824 phosphorylation in xenograft tumors. XL495 reduces tumor growth in colorectal and breast cancer xenograft models, and achieves tumor regression with DNA-damaging agents in colorectal cancer xenograft models. XL495 can be used for the research of cancer, such as breast cancer and colorectal cancer. -

ZNL-02-096
0 ImagesCat. No.: HY-208742CAS No.: 2414418-56-5ZNL-02-096 is a selective Wee1 PROTAC degrader. ZNL-02-096 binds to CRBN and Wee1 to form a ternary complex, inducing CRBN- and proteasome-dependent ubiquitination and proteasomal degradation of Wee1. ZNL-02-096 inhibits recombinant PLK1 with an IC50 of 102 nM, but does not induce its degradation in cells. ZNL-02-096 induces G2/M phase arrest, Apoptosis, transient integrated stress response, upregulation of ATF4, and phosphorylation of GCN2. ZNL-02-096 reduces Tyr15 phosphorylation of CDK1. ZNL-02-096 can be used in research related to ovarian cancer, acute lymphoblastic leukemia, triple-negative breast cancer, multiple myeloma, and pancreatic ductal adenocarcinoma. -

PD 407824
0 ImagesPD 407824 is a checkpoint kinase Chk1 and WEE1 inhibitor with IC50s of 47 and 97 nM, respectively. PD 407824 is a chemical BMP sensitizer and increases the sensitivity of cells to sub-threshold amounts of BMP4. -

WEE1 degrader 1
0 ImagesWEE1 degrader 1 (Compound 10) is a CRBN-dependent molecular glue degrader of WEE1 and casein kinase 1α (CK1α) with sub-2 nM DC50 values for both targets. WEE1 degrader 1 can be used for the research of acute lymphoblastic leukemia, acute monocytic leukemia, acute promyelocytic leukemia, colorectal adenocarcinoma, diffuse large b cell lymphoma. -
